Transaction fe4454553709d2e1235004cde663ca9715217856311fe4a5d5b77ae82cc07a67
2 Input
2 Outputs
- fe4454553709d2e1235004cde663ca9715217856311fe4a5d5b77ae82cc07a67:0
- fe4454553709d2e1235004cde663ca9715217856311fe4a5d5b77ae82cc07a67:1
value 22912740
address 1EWD52fizEJRRXy84sC1Km4obk1pcuvirH
value 62009094
address 3EApa7zpNNBC28vmvxnZC1s84DEsGxekps